As Built (Final Reso.) <br />RESOLUTION NO. 99- 54 <br />5M(resolasbullt)VWDC <br />A RESOLUTION OF INDIAN RIVER COUNTY, FLORIDA, <br />CERTIFYING "AS -BUILT" COSTS FOR INSTALLATION OF <br />WATER SERVICE TO CHERRYWOOD ESTATES <br />SUBDIVISION (59TH AVENUE, SOUTH OF 33RD STREET) AND <br />SUCH OTHER CONSTRUCTION NECESSITATED BY SUCH <br />PROJECT; PROVIDING FOR FORMAL COMPLETION DATE, <br />AND DATE FOR PAYMENT WITHOUT PENALTY AND <br />INTEREST. <br />W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of Indian River County determined that <br />water improvements for properties located within the area of Cherrywood Estates Subdivision <br />are necessary to promote the public welfare of the county; and <br />WHEREAS, on Tuesday, September 8, 1998, the Board held a public hearing at which <br />time and place the owners of property to be assessed appeared before the Board to be heard <br />as to the propriety and advisability of making such improvements; and <br />WHEREAS, after such public hearing was held the County Commission adopted <br />Resolution No. 98-93, which confirmed the special assessment cost of the project to the <br />property specially benefited by the project in the amounts listed in the attachment to that <br />resolution; and <br />WHEREAS,- the Director of Utility Services has certified the actual 'as-builto cost now <br />that the project has been completed is less than in confirming Resolution No. 98-93, <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F COUNTY <br />COMMISSIONERS OF INDIAN RIVER COUNTY, FLORIDA, as follows: <br />1. Resolution No. 98-93 is modified as follows: The due date for the referenced project and <br />the last day that payment may be made avoiding interest and penalty charges is ninety days <br />after passage of this resolution. <br />2. Payments bearing interest at the rate of 7.75Yo per annum may be made in ten annual <br />installments, the first to be made twelve months from the due date. The due date is the date <br />of passage of this resolution. <br />3. The final assessment roll for the project listed in Resolution No. 98-93 shall be as shown on <br />the attached Exhibit "A." <br />4. The assessments, as shown on the attached Exhibit "A," shall stand confirmed, and will <br />remain legal, valid, and binding first liens against the property against which such <br />assessments are made until paid. <br />5. The assessments shown on Exhibit "A," attached to Resolution No. 98-93, were recorded <br />by the County on the public records of Indian River County, and the lien shall remain prima <br />facie evidence of its validity. <br />The resolution was moved for adoption by Commissioner G i n n , and the motion was <br />seconded by Commissioner S t a n b r i d 9 eand, upon being put to a vote, the vote was as <br />follows: <br />Chairman Kenneth R.
